Sanity briefly broke out in female college athletics on Monday when the
NCAA announced their pared-down list of candidates eligible for the
organization’s Woman of the Year award, and UPenn swimmer Lia Thomas — a
biological male identifying as a female — was no longer eligible for the
award. The male Thomas had been among 547 candidates for the female award
when UPenn nominated him earlier this month.

Thomas’ name was not among the 151 conference nominees released on Monday.

The Ivy League’s candidate for Woman of the Year will instead be Columbia
University fencer Sylvie Binder. Binder was the NCAA Women’s Foil Champion
in 2019 and placed third overall this year. Binder has already been
honored with the 2022 Women’s Connie S. Maniatty Award as Columbia’s top
senior student-athlete.

Thomas’ main claim to fame was winning an NCAA swimming championship as a
biological male competing against females. Prior to beginning his
“transition” to female in 2019, Thomas had competed on UPenn’s men’s
swimming team as a middle-of-the-pack competitor.

OutKick Sports called it a “major upset” that Thomas didn’t go on to win
the award.

“This week, conferences were asked to declare a Woman of the Year and the
Ivy League did the unthinkable and bypassed Thomas for — a biological
woman, first-team All-American fencer Sylvie Binder from Columbia
University,” wrote OutKick’s Joe Kinsey.


The NCAA’s Woman of the Year award is largely based on 1972’s Title IX
law, which was intended to stop sex-based discrimination in the classroom,
and by extension, athletics.

“The NCAA Woman of the Year program is rooted in Title IX and has
recognized graduating female college athletes for excellence in academics,
athletics, community service and leadership since its inception in 1991,”
reads the award’s mission statement.
